Suitable Temperature Level Array for Paint



When taking into consideration exterior painting tasks, the suitable temperature level variety plays an essential role in accomplishing optimum results. Painting in the appropriate temperature problems ensures that the paint sticks properly to the surface area, dries out equally, and treatments effectively. Normally, the suggested temperature level range for outside painting is between 50 to 85 degrees Fahrenheit.

Paint in temperatures below 50 degrees Fahrenheit can lead to problems such as poor paint attachment, prolonged drying times, and a boosted likelihood of cracking or peeling.

On the other hand, painting in temperature levels over 85 levels Fahrenheit can cause the paint to completely dry as well promptly, leading to blistering, gurgling, and an uneven surface.

To attain the best outcomes, it is vital to check the weather prediction before beginning an outside paint job. Preferably, purpose to repaint throughout mild weather conditions with moderate temperature levels and reduced moisture levels.

Effects of Moisture on Paint Drying



Humidity levels substantially impact the drying out process of paint put on exterior surface areas. High moisture can extend the drying out time of paint, causing possible concerns such as dripping, streaking, and even the formation of bubbles on the repainted surface area. Excess wetness in the air slows down the evaporation of water from the paint, impeding the healing procedure. This is especially bothersome for water-based paints, as they count on evaporation for drying out.

On the other hand, low humidity degrees can also affect paint drying. Exceptionally completely dry conditions might cause the paint to completely dry also promptly, leading to poor attachment and a rough coating. In such instances, including a paint conditioner or spraying a fine haze of water in the air can assist control moisture levels and improve the paint end result.

To ensure optimum drying problems, it is advisable to paint when the humidity levels vary between 40% and 50%.



Monitoring humidity degrees and taking ideal measures can help accomplish a smooth and long lasting paint surface on exterior surface areas.

On the other hand, precipitation, whether rain or snow, can be incredibly damaging to the result of an outside painting project. Dampness from rainfall can impede paint bond, triggering peeling off and bubbling over time. It is critical to avoid paint throughout wet or snowy climate to guarantee the long life and top quality of the paint job. Painters ought to additionally permit adequate time for the surface to dry extensively after any kind of rainfall before commencing or returning to the paint process.
